Dental bridges in Seminole mean bridging the gap created by one or more missing teeth. A bridge is made up of two or more crowns which serve as an anchor. These are custom-made placed on healthy and prosthetic teeth. These artificial teeth known as pontics are made of gold, alloys, porcelain or a combination of these materials. Dental implants or natural teeth support dental bridges.
There are 3 main types of dental bridges-
-
- Traditional bridges
The dentist in 33778 creates a crown and implant on either side of the missing tooth. There is a pontic in between. This type of bridges is made of porcelain bonded with metal or ceramics.
-
- Cantilever bridges
When one or more teeth are missing near the adjacent teeth, then these types of bridges are used. It is not recommended for the back teeth as it can put a lot of pressures on the other teeth and damages them.
-
- Maryland bonded bridges
These are also known as a resin-bonded bridge made of porcelain which is bonded to metal or plastic teeth and gums supported by a metal or porcelain framework. The one side of the bridge is only attached to the existing teeth.
Benefits of dental bridges-
- Restores the smile, ability to chew and speak
- Enhances the shape of the face
- Replaces the missing teeth and distribute the force in bite
- Saves the other from shifting from the place
Process of a dental bridge
During the first visit, the dentist in Seminole will clean the enamel and prepare the abutment teeth for the placement of the crown. They will take the impressions of the teeth to make a bridge, pontic and crowns. Meanwhile, the temporary bridge is placed to protect the exposed teeth and gums.
In the second visit, the dentist will remove the temporary bridge and metal bridge is placed and adjusted for a proper fit. The patient needs to go to the dentist multiple times to get the fit of the bridges checked.
In case of a fixed bridge, the dentist will cement the bridge temporarily for a few weeks to ensure the proper fit. After a few weeks, the bridge is cemented into place.
The cost of dental bridges depends on the type of bridges selected and procedure performed by the dentist in Largo. Many insurance companies pay a percentage of fees depending on the individual dental plan.
Dental bridges last for 5 to 15 years and even longer with proper care. The lifespan of a fixed bridge can be increased by maintaining good oral hygiene and regular check-ups.
The dentist recommends eating soft foods which can be cut into small pieces easily until you become used to bridges. Therefore, replacing the missing teeth with a dental bridge will make the eating, chewing and speaking abilities effective.
The bridges are successful and strong if the surrounding teeth are healthy.
